Today I received some notices about Hotmail users who couldn't send e-mail
messages to various receipients due to spamfilters blocking them at the
receiving mailservers. Seems like Microsoft/Hotmail staff forgot to set some
reverse DNS pointer records:
Diagnostic-Code: smtp;450 4.7.1 Client host rejected: cannot find your
reverse hostname, [157.55.1.150]
(Verified this using various public DNS servers, to exclude potential local
issues)
Anyone here who has proper contacts to give them the clue-bat?
